Chris Cuffe
Chris Cuffe has been actively involved in the investment and non-profit sectors for many years and currently maintains a portfolio of roles across both industries. Since 2009, his activities have included serving as a Non-Executive Director of listed investment companies Staude Capital Global Value Fund Limited and Hearts and Minds Investments Limited, where he is also Chairman. He is also a Non-Executive Director of Keyview Partners, a private markets asset manager, and a member of the investment committees of several ultra-high-net-worth families and Scarcity Partners, which provides capital and sector expertise to investment management businesses with significant growth potential. Chris is the portfolio manager of the $420 million Australian Philanthropic Services Foundation General Portfolio, a public ancillary fund, and is the founder, director and portfolio manager of the Third Link Growth Fund, a public Australian equities fund where all management fees received are donated to charity.
Earlier in his career, Chris served as a director of UniSuper from 2007 to 2011 and as Chairman from 2011 to 2017, while also sitting on its investment committee from 2009 to 2025. He also founded Australian Philanthropic Services, a not-for-profit organisation that inspires, facilitates and educates Australia’s high-net-worth community and the professional advisers who support them about effective philanthropy, and served as Chairman from 2012 to 2025.

David Wright
David Wright is the portfolio manager of the Australian Philanthropic Services (APS) Foundation Focused Portfolio. He is the co-founder and former CEO and Investment Director of Zenith Investment Partners, a leading provider of independent investment research and portfolio construction advice. He has a wealth of investment industry experience acquired over his extensive career including senior positions at IWL Ltd as Head of Research and Associate Director and Head of Managed Funds research at Lonsdale Limited.
David is also a Director and Chairman of the Investment Committee for ASX-listed Hearts & Minds Investments, a member of the Qantas Superannuation Investment Committee and the Deakin University Financial Planning Advisory Board.

Jason Coggins
Jason has over 20 years of experience in financial services, spanning banking, private wealth, and asset consultancy. Until 2023, he spent nearly a decade at Koda Capital as Head of Funds Research, playing a key role in shaping the firm’s investment strategy from its inception. His responsibilities included supporting asset allocation, portfolio construction, and strategy selection. During his tenure, the Investment Strategy Group (ISG) gained recognition for introducing and seeding innovative strategies in the Australian market. The team also played a pivotal role in securing some of the country’s largest non-profit organisations and high-net-worth family offices. Prior to Koda Capital, Jason co-led the research team at ANZ Global Wealth, overseeing ANZ’s centralised advice research function. Earlier in his career, he worked at CPG/Grove Financial Services, an institutional asset consultancy firm.
Jason holds a number of consulting and advisory roles across the investment industry, including Head of Investment Strategy at Ellerston Capital, and also serves on the Investment Committee of Lipman Burgon, the Advisory Board of Aura Group, and the investment committees of several family offices.
Jason holds a Bachelor of Economics and a Bachelor of Business Management from the University of Queensland.
